solidworks问题,有解决过这个问题的吗 内部错误:该产品组件的 Windows Installer 没按预期运行: 1903。

solidworks问题,有解决过这个问题的吗?解决过的幇一下,急急急!!!
误删过一些文件,然后就运行不了了。重装就出现这个问题了。修复也不行,就是卡在这里。

内部错误:该产品组件的 Windows Installer 没按预期运行: 1903。
内部错误:该产品组件的 Windows Installer 没按预期运行: 1903
与技术支持部联系。

在与技术支持部门联系有关安装问题时,您需要提供位于此目录中的安装日志文件:。使用以下按钮将您的日志保存为 zip 文件以发送给您的支持代

原因:与“Microsoft Visual C++”产生冲突。

1、首先打开左下角开始菜单栏,选择打开“控制面板”选项。

2、然后在弹出来的窗口中点击打开程序下面的“卸载程序”选项。

3、然后在弹出来的窗口中卸载所有以《Microsoft Visual C++》开头的程序。

4、然后就可以解决这个问题,正常使用solidworks了。

温馨提示:答案为网友推荐,仅供参考
第1个回答  2019-06-26

这个错误的发生原因可能是因为msi.dll相关的组件未注册,导致未开启windows installer服务,进而导致solidworks安装失败的结果。

因为Windows Installer 不仅仅是一个安装程序,它还是一个可扩展的软件管理系统,它管理着软件的安装,管理软件组件的添加和删除,监视文件复原,并通过使用回滚来维护基本的灾难恢复。相关的解决方法如下:

1、首先需要注册msi.dll相关组件:,点击【开始】,选择【运行】,输入“cmd”,打开cmd命令窗口;

2、然后在cmd命令窗口中输入regsvr32 msi.dll(注意空格!),然后按下回车,提示注册成功即可;

3、再次打开【运行】,输入“services.msc”后按下回车,进入服务窗口开启服务;

4、在服务列表中按字母顺序找到【windows installer】,然后双击打开;

5、选择启动类型, 只要保证这个服务是处于启动状态即可,点击【启动】,最后点击【确认】并关闭窗口即可。

参考资料来源:百度百科-windows installer

本回答被网友采纳
第2个回答  推荐于2017-12-15
很巧,我今天下午刚卸了2012sp0,然后和你出现了同样的问题,搜了下关于这方面的答案,刚刚重装成功,那我就把我看到的方法综合一下你试试吧,不知道你哪个版本的,不过解决方法应该是一样,这个问题主要是由于电脑里面有关sld的文件没有删除成功,好吧,开始说方法!
1、Micorsoft visual studio 2005 tools for applications在重装之前把这个卸载了,清理下注册表
2、我的是装在D盘的,所以把C盘、D盘的所有有关solidworks的文件及文件夹删除干净,可以尝试在搜索里面输入so搜索关于solidworks的文件,然后找到全部删了
3、用360再次把痕迹和注册表清理一下吧
4、重启电脑
5、拔掉网线,重装软件
6、应该就会成功了
就这些了,欢迎追问,自己码的字,只为帮助更多的机械苦逼一族,望采纳!本回答被网友采纳
第3个回答  2013-03-02
用360强力卸载下,然后C盘所有文件夹(包括隐藏文件夹)里一个个找,一般只会在【program files】、【program data】、【app data】和【user】(可能是【用户】)这几个里面,把带“sld”、“dassault”这几个字母的文件和文件夹全部删掉,最后用360清理一下注册表,重启电脑,再安装一下试试。来自:求助得到的回答
第3个回答  2013-03-02
你先重启一下电脑,然后再双击一次安装程序,点“修改安装程序”,把所有的勾都挑上,安装即可!
相似回答